Essential Tips and Tricks for Efficient Excel Use
Mastering Microsoft Excel can highly enhance your productivity. Here are some essential tips and tricks to help you utilize this powerful tool more efficiently. Begin by arranging your data in a clear and concise manner, utilizing titles for each column. This will make it more accessible to analyze and interpret your information. Utilize Excel's functions to automate tasks and perform complex calculations. Learn common formulas like SUM, AVERAGE, and COUNT to efficiently process data. Explore the comprehensive library of default functions to simplify your workflows.
- Discover keyboard shortcuts to enhance your navigation and data entry.
- Implement conditional formatting to highlight important trends or outliers in your data.
- Become proficient pivot tables for compiling large datasets and gaining actionable insights.
Practice regularly to sharpen your Excel skills and discover new approaches. Remember, consistency is essential to becoming a proficient Excel user.
Data Visualization Best Practices in Excel Effective Excel Visualization Strategies
When crafting compelling data visualizations in Excel, certain best practices can elevate your charts and graphs from ordinary to extraordinary. Start by specifying your goals. What insights do you want to illustrate? Once you have a clear objective, choose the most suitable chart type to show your data. Consider your audience and tailor the visualization level accordingly. Remember to utilize clear labels, succinct titles, and a eye-catching color palette to boost readability and impact.
- Employ a logical scale for your axes to avoid distortion.
- Underscore key trends and patterns with annotations or callouts.
- Showcase data in a coherent manner, using legends and tooltips to clarify elements effectively.
By adhering to these best practices, you can create data visualizations in Excel that are both insightful and captivating for your audience.
